TommyPROM/unlock-ben-eater-hardware/README.md

23 lines
1.0 KiB
Markdown
Raw Permalink Normal View History

# Unlock Ben Eater Hardware
2020-08-10 18:18:10 +00:00
2023-10-09 03:58:59 +00:00
![Ben Eater EEPROM Programmer](../docs/_docs/images/ben-eater-hardware.jpg)
2020-08-10 18:18:10 +00:00
Utility to unlock 28C256 Software Data Protection (SDP) for the
[Ben Eater EEPROM](https://github.com/beneater/eeprom-programmer)
programmer design. This hardware is similar to the TommyPROM hardware, but it uses
different shift register chips and different pin assignments.
To meet the
2024-03-09 01:07:51 +00:00
[timing requirements of the SDP unlock](https://tomnisbet.github.io/TommyPROM/docs/28C256-notes),
this code uses direct port writes
2020-08-10 18:18:10 +00:00
to set and read values on the data bus. It will work with Arduino Uno and Nano hardware,
but would require changes for other platforms.
2020-08-09 01:28:41 +00:00
**NOTE** that this sketch **will not** work on TommyPROM hardware. It is included here
to help people with locked chips who are using the Ben Eater design.
2023-10-09 03:58:59 +00:00
![Unlock timing with Ben Eater Hardware](../docs/_docs/images/ben-eater-unlock-timing.png)
The timing trace shows the tBLC for the bytes of the unlock sequence within 65us, well
within the required 150us in the datasheet.